Steve & I eat a lot of asian food because it’s easy to make gluten free, so when I was picking up some soy sauce last week, I noticed this boxed meal with a helpful little gluten free label right on the front of the box.
I’m always looking for new quick and easy gluten free meals, so I thought I’d try it out.
I added my own chicken and my own chopped peanuts when I made it, but you could also add vegetables if you wanted.
The instructions were easy and the meal came together pretty quickly, and it was definitely delicious!
Here’s the score:
Price: $2.47 at Walmart – 5/5
Prep/cooking time: varies depending on if you used pre-cooked chicken or have to cook it, but 20-30 minutes – 3.5/5
Taste: 5/5
Husband’s Approval: 5/5
